At Instructure, we believe in the power of people to grow and succeed throughout their lives. Our goal is to amplify that power by creating intuitive products that simplify learning and personal development, facilitate meaningful relationships, and inspire people to go further in their education and careers. We do this by giving smart, creative, passionate people opportunities to create awesome. Our cloud-native solutions serve more than 8,000 educational institutions in over 100 countries. We are redefining software engineering by embedding Artificial Intelligence throughout our development lifecycle to multiply engineering velocity, code quality, and security. We are seeking an autonomous, high-impact Senior Software Engineer to join our core product engineering team dedicated to Canvas LMS—the cornerstone open-source ecosystem powering global education. In this role, your playground will be your entire team’s area, and you will drive work from definition to delivery with minimal support, unblocking yourself and others. This is not a traditional development role. You will join an elite, highly efficient engineering team that treats AI tools like Claude Code and Gemini as core workflow primitives. You will champion the use of AI to scale productivity, improve test coverage, enforce security gates, and compress the build-review-validate loop for a true multiplier effect.
Stand Out From the Crowd
Upload your resume and get instant feedback on how well it matches this job.
Job Type
Full-time
Career Level
Senior
Education Level
No Education Listed